Here weve taken our previous responsive example and added some flex utilities and a margin utility on the button to right align the buttons when theyre no longer stacked. Additional utilities can be used to adjust the alignment of buttons when horizontal. Please see https://icons.getbootstrap.com/, this page lists available icons and their names. Weve included details for Bootstrap Icons and other preferred icon sets below.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Topic: Bootstrap / Sass Prev|Next Answer: Use the CSS position Property. Dark Once unpublished, all posts by behainguyen will become hidden and only accessible to themselves. Bootstrap Trash Icon Symbolizes trash-can, garbage, and delete. How To Create Icon Buttons Step 1) Add HTML: Add an icon library, such as font awesome, and append icons to HTML buttons: Example <!-- Add icon library --> <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7./css/font-awesome.min.css"> <!-- Add font awesome icons to buttons --> <p> Icon buttons: </p> However, you can also use these classes on or elements (though some browsers may apply a slightly different rendering). Feel free to use them or any other icon set in your project. You can use it like this: Some future-friendly styles are included to disable all, Designed and built with all the love in the world by the. Each .btn-* modifier class updates the appropriate CSS variables to minimize additional CSS rules with our button-variant(), button-outline-variant(), and button-size() mixins. Bootstrap has very few icon needs out of the box, so we didn't need much. You can assign a .bg-* class to the icon and increase the padding but with more icons, you will notice that they are of different sizes. Secondary Ensure that information denoted by the color is either obvious from the content itself (e.g. If behainguyen is not suspended, they can still re-publish their posts from their dashboard. Since icons are generally used to deal with the intuitiveness of UI design, Bootstrap icon buttons tend to increase it. Trash Icon is given below. Bootstrap v5.2 View on GitHub Buttons Use Bootstrap's custom button styles for actions in forms, dialogs, and more with support for multiple sizes, states, and more. Why is sending so few tanks to Ukraine considered significant? If youre pre-toggling a button, you must manually add the .active class and aria-pressed="true" to the , , , , , W3Schools is optimized for learning and training. the visible text), or is included through alternative means, such as additional text hidden with the .visually-hidden class. It may contain an icon only or text with an icon. What did it sound like when you played the cassette tape with programs on it? To create a button with only an icon and no text, simply remove the label: I've created a simple HTML page which shows a few buttons which I'm using in my project: The live URL of the example page: https://behai-nguyen.github.io/demo/042/bootstrap-5-button-icon.html. Note that you can create single input-powered buttons or groups of them. If you want the icon to be a menu replace the <button> element with <a> and remove the .btn .btn-primary classes. There are two buttons in the design. Once unsuspended, behainguyen will be able to comment and publish posts again. All Rights Reserved. The general syntax for using Bootstrap icons is: Where class-name is the name of the particular icon class, e.g. Tailwind dropdown The .btn classes are designed to be used with the